The Open House Project
The goal is not to radically rework every Congressional procedure. The operating principle of the Open House Project is known as Paving the Cowpaths. Our recommendations included some very unobtrusive ways to open up the House, low-hanging fruit where the Internet and Congressional procedures come together, though the report also contains several more high-reaching aspirations. The potential of this project lies in the possibility of experts and citizens from all fields to come together and identify areas where Congress can open up and allows all of us to have more information and access.
